OnITRoad - SQL Server 2008
如何在SQL Server中发送测试电子邮件
如何在SQL Server中发送测试电子邮件 在本文中,将介绍如何在SQL Server中发送测试电子邮件。 我们可以从SQL Server发送电子邮件。 在发送电子邮件之前,我们必须在SQL Server中配置电子邮件。 在SQL Server中发送测试电子邮件的步骤 第1步:启动SQL Server: 第2步:节约管理和选择数据库邮件=>然后单击"发送测试邮件":
Views:0 2020-06-02
在Transact-SQL中如何测试数据库对象是否存在
在Transact-SQL中如何测试数据库对象是否存在 在本文中,将介绍如何在Transact-SQL中检查数据库对象是否存在。 数据库对象 有许多类型的数据库对象,如视图,存储过程和用户定义函数。 要检查这些对象和数据库的存在,SQL Server会提供object_id和db_id等方法。 object_id函数用于检查表,视图,存储过程和用户定义功能的存在。 db_id用于检查特定数据库的存
Views:0 2020-06-02
在SQL中如何使用游标更新和删除数据
在SQL中如何使用游标更新和删除数据 使用游标更新数据 我们可以在SQL中使用游标更新数据。 update vendors set vendorname = 'apple' where current of cur_bill 使用游标删除数据 我们还可以使用游标删除数据。 delete vendors where current of invinfo_cur1
Views:0 2020-06-02
如何在SQL中更新和删除触发器
如何在SQL中更新和删除触发器 在本文中,将介绍如何在SQL中更新和删除触发器。 SQL中的触发器是在视图或者表上执行的操作查询自动执行,触发或者调用的特殊类型。 我们可以在插入,删除和更新或者这些操作组合时设置触发器。 当我们需要更新任何触发器更新触发语句时,存在许多情况用于在SQL中更新触发器。 我们使用DROP TRIGGER语句来删除触发器。 创建vendors表 create table
Views:0 2020-06-02
在SQL中如何更新数据库表的数据
在SQL中如何更新数据库表的数据 在本文中,将介绍如何在数据库中更新数据。 我们使用更新语句来更新表或者数据库中的数据。 该语句是DML(数据操作语言)的一部分。 在很多情况下,我们需要更新数据库中的数据。为了更新数据库中的数据,我们还在update语句中添加了一些条件。 更新在oiremp表中的数据 update oiremp set name = 'jackma' where name = '
Views:0 2020-06-02
如何在 SQL 中使用联接更新数据
如何在 SQL 中使用联接更新数据 在本文中,将介绍如何在 SQL 中使用联接更新数据。 联接运算符用于从两个或者两个以上的表中获取数据。 如果您想根据其他表中的条件更新表中的任何值,那么我们使用 join。 联接创建两个表之间的关系。 更新 billtbl 表中数据的语句 UPDATE dbo.billtbl SET billtotal=50000 FROM dbo.billtbl JOIN
Views:0 2020-06-02
如何在 SQL 中使用视图更新行
如何在 SQL 中使用视图更新行 在本文中,将介绍如何使用 SQL 中的视图更新行 SQL 中的视图是一个虚拟表,该表是在 SQL 语句的结果集上创建的。 视图类似于普通表,也有行和列。 视图可能是两个或者两个以上表的某些行和列的组合。 您可以在 SQL 语句中将 SQL 函数和 WHERE 子句与 View 一起使用。 您可以使用 SQL 中的视图更新行。 要修改视图,我们使用 ALTER VI
Views:0 2020-06-02
如何在SQL中使用子查询更新表
如何在SQL中使用子查询更新表 我们可以使用 SQL 中的子查询更新表中的数据。 要更新表,我们可以在 SET、FROM 和 WHERE 子句中编写子查询。 示例 UPDATE dbo.billtbl SET creadittotal = creadittotal+100, paymenttotal = (SELECT MAX(paymenttotal) FROM dbo.billtbl) WH
Views:0 2020-06-02
如何在 SQL 中使用 AFTER 触发器
如何在 SQL 中使用 AFTER 触发器 在本文中,将介绍如何在 SQL 中使用 AFTER 触发器。 SQL 中的触发器是一种特殊类型的过程,可自动执行、触发或者调用以响应在视图或者表上执行的操作查询。 我们可以在插入、删除和更新或者这些操作的组合上设置触发器。 SQL 中有三种类型的触发器。 AFTER 触发器 INSTEAD OF 触发器 FOR 触发器 SQL 中的 After 触发
Views:0 2020-06-02
如何在 SQL 中使用 ALL 关键字
如何在 SQL 中使用 ALL 关键字 SQL中的ALL关键字用于测试子查询返回的所有值的比较条件是否为真。 我们将 ALL 关键字与 >、<、>= 和 <= 等比较运算符一起使用。 例子 SELECT * FROM dbo.billtbl WHERE billtotal > ALL ( SELECT billtotal FROM dbo.billtbl WHE
Views:0 2020-06-02
如何在SQL中使用ANY关键字
如何在SQL中使用ANY关键字 SQL 中的 ANY 关键字用于测试子查询返回的一个或者多个值的比较条件是否为真。 我们将 ANY 关键字与诸如 >、<、>= 和 <= 等比较运算符一起使用。 ANY 和 SOME 是等效的关键字。 关键字 ANY 和 SOME 提供相同的输出。 例子 select vendorname,billtbl.vendorid,billtotal
Views:0 2020-06-02
在SQL SERVER中如何使用CASE函数
在SQL SERVER中如何使用CASE函数 SQL CASE 函数 Case函数根据条件执行一系列语句。 SQL 中的 CASE 函数通过将第一个表达式与每个 WHEN 子句中的表达式进行比较来进行操作。 Case 函数中等价的表达式,THEN 子句中的表达式将被执行。 SQL CASE 函数示例 declare @st_marks int, @st_result varchar(15)
Views:0 2020-06-02
在SQL中如何使用COALESCE函数
在SQL中如何使用COALESCE函数 COALESCE 函数用于从值列表中查找非空值。 它返回表达式列表中不为空的第一个表达式。 如果所有表达式都有空值,则返回空值。 ISNULL 也返回非空值,但 COALESCE 函数在使用上比 ISNULL 函数更灵活。 查看 billtbl 表的数据 select * from dbo.billtbl order by billid desc 使用C
Views:0 2020-06-02
如何在带HAVING子句 SQL中使用CUBE运算符
如何在带HAVING子句 SQL中使用CUBE运算符 在本文中,将介绍如何在SQL中使用带有HAVING子句的CUBE运算符。GROUPBY子句用于根据一个或者多个列或者表达式对结果集的行进行分组。GROUPBY子句用于包含聚合函数的SELECT语句中。 WITH CUBE运算符在GROUPBY子句中用于将摘要行添加到最终结果集。GROUPBY子句中指定的每个组组合都由多维数据集运算符汇总。CUB
Views:0 2020-06-02
在SQL中使用游标@@fetch_status函数
在SQL中使用游标@@fetch_status函数 @@FETCH_STATUS 系统函数 @@FETCH_STATUS 系统函数用于查找最近的 FETCH 语句。 您可以将此函数与 while 循环一起使用。 @@FETCH_STATUS 系统函数返回 0 或者 1。返回 0 表示 FETCH 成功且等于 0。 当它返回 1 时,表示 FETCH 不成功并且等于 1。 用于创建 billtbl
Views:0 2020-06-02
如何在 SQL 中将 IN 运算符与子查询一起使用
如何在 SQL 中将 IN 运算符与子查询一起使用 在本文中,将介绍如何在 SQL 中使用带有子查询的 IN 运算符。 如果在另一个 SQL 语句中编码,则称为子查询的选择语句。 子查询可以返回单个值或者结果集。 此结果集可能包含单列或者多列。 在 SELECT 语句中有四种创建子查询的方法。 在 WHERE 子句中 在 HAVING 子句中 在 FROM 子句中 在 SELECT 子句中 您
Views:0 2020-06-02